Subject: Prototype shipment to Quillbarrow Test Facility — dispatch request. Dispatch desk: please arrange collection of two crated Solverin prototype units from Building C staging by Friday noon. Records team, log the crate serials, the sealed-tamper tags, and the signed release form in the transport register before the crates move. Photograph all seals at pick-up. The confidential instruction for the courier hand-over follows immediately below.

drop instructions, yafog-yawip: the quenmir olidor courier leaves the julox tamion keliel ledger at gate 5283 under passcode 336825

Subject: DR Drill — Castbridge Feed Validator

Team, next Tuesday we rehearse full recovery of the Castbridge podcast feed validator. Support should follow the Orvane runbook step by step, noting any gaps. We will restore the validation ruleset from the offsite Pellam archive. To decrypt that archive during the drill, use the recovery passphrase below.

strongbox words: praath-pelys-ulaion

- [ ] Key ceremony, step 7 (Squatternet scanner signing root): Security reviewer confirms the typo-squatting package scanner's offline signing key was generated on the air-gapped Marholt workstation, witnessed by two custodians, and that the sealed envelope matches the ledger entry. Before sealing, the reviewer verifies the restore path by reading back the recovery passphrase recorded below.

strongbox words: oliix-praax